Job Description

This position offers an opportunity for a skilled Speech-Language Pathologist to provide essential services within a school setting in Wyoming, MI. The role is travel-based, allowing professionals to engage with diverse educational environments while delivering therapeutic support to students.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Conduct speech and language evaluations to identify communication disorders in students.
  • Develop and implement individualized treatment plans tailored to each student's needs.
  • Collaborate with educators and parents to support student progress and communication goals.
  • Maintain accurate documentation and reports in compliance with school policies.
  • Participate in team meetings and contribute to multidisciplinary approaches for student success.

Qualifications and Experience:

  • Valid certification and licensure as a Speech-Language Pathologist.
  • Experience working in educational settings, particularly with children and adolescents.
  • Strong assessment and intervention skills for a variety of speech and language disorders.
  • Excellent communication and collaboration abilities.
  • Flexibility and adaptability to travel to multiple school locations within the assignment region.
